Legendary singer and actress Cher is known for her quick wit, chart-topping hits, and award-winning performances. Cher's life story is now being told on Broadway in "The Cher Show." The lead is played by three actresses. Gayle King met with the ladies of the show and Cher herself, who opened up about the joys and challenges of bringing her story to stage.
